At least six people are killed, including the perpetrator, and 35 others are injured in a suicide bombing by a Boko Haram terrorist at a mosque in Maiduguri, Borno State, Nigeria. 2025-12-24
A Nigerian court sentences Biafran separatist Nnamdi Kanu to life imprisonment on seven terrorism charges over his leadership of the Indigenous People of Biafra militant group. 2025-11-20
Over 50 people are massacred by suspected Boko Haram fighters in Rann, Nigeria. 2022-05-22
President Goodluck Jonathan of Nigeria wins the presidential election held on 16 April. 2011-04-20
Nigeria's ruling People's Democratic Party nominates incumbent President Goodluck Jonathan as its candidate for April presidential elections. 2011-01-14
Thousands of members of Nigeria's ruling People's Democratic Party begin voting on whether incumbent President Goodluck Jonathan should be their choice of candidate in April presidential elections. 2011-01-13
The Nigerian opposition Congress for Progressive Change party select former military ruler Muhammadu Buhari as its presidential candidate for April elections. 2011-01-5
Former Nigerian Vice President Atiku Abubakar is chosen to challenge incumbent President Goodluck Jonathan for the ruling People's Democratic Party nomination in next year's presidential election. 2010-11-22
1986 Nobel Laureate for Literature Wole Soyinka, the first African to receive the award, launches a political party ahead of Nigeria's upcoming presidential election. 2010-09-25
Nigerian President Goodluck Jonathan announces he will contest the presidential election in January 2011. 2010-09-15
